Many fans are extremely excited for the Kingdom Come Deliverance sequel, and for all the good reasons. After the last game’s massive success, the expectations of the community for the RPG have tripled. However, KDM2 found itself in a steep controversy even before its launch came within anyone’s reach. A rumor sprawling from the depths of the web last month implied that it would feature Denuvo.

The hearsay caused a lot of backlash, which the developers have now officially addressed. Warhorse Studios recently confirmed in an online live stream that the rumors of Denuvo were entirely false. 

Why it matters: The Kingdom Come Deliverance sequel’s lack of Denuvo has comforted a slew of angry fans who believed the rumors. The first game also did not utilize the controversial anti-cheat.

Kingdom Come Deliverance 2 will be an action-packed RPG that completely evolves the elements of its predecessors.
Kingdom Come Deliverance 2 will completely evolve the elements of its predecessors.

During the two-hour live stream on Twitch, the studio’s global pr manager, Tobias Stolz-Zwilling, mentioned that Kingdom Come Deliverance 2 will launch without the Denuvo anti-cheat. He also urged everyone not to bring up the topic again after the developers received a barrage of messages from the worried community.

There were some discussions, of course, there was some misinformation, but at the end of the day, there won’t be any Denuvo at all, and with that, I would like you to close the case already.

-Tobias Stolz-Zwilling

Fans were originally concerned because Deep Silver has shipped some of its latest PC releases with Denuvo. Regardless, to give us an idea of high-end system requirements, a dev said that NVIDIA RTX 4080 Super should run the RPG with 60fps at 4K or very high settings.

Kingdom Come Deliverance 2 is set to release on February 11, 2025, for PC, PlayStation 5, and Xbox Series X|S.
